#480efb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#480efb is composed of 28.2% red, 5.5% green and 98.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.3% cyan, 94.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 1.6% black. It has a hue angle of 254.7 degrees, a saturation of 96.7% and a lightness of 52%. #480efb color hex could be obtained by blending #901cff with #0000f7. Closest websafe color is: #3300ff.

#480efb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#480efb has RGB values of R:72, G:14, B:251 and CMYK values of C:0.71, M:0.94, Y:0,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 4722427.

Hex triplet 480efb #480efb
RGB Decimal 72, 14, 251 rgb(72,14,251)
RGB Percent 28.2, 5.5, 98.4 rgb(28.2%,5.5%,98.4%)
CMYK 71, 94, 0, 2
HSL 254.7°, 96.7, 52 hsl(254.7,96.7%,52%)
HSV (or HSB) 254.7°, 94.4, 98.4
Web Safe 3300ff #3300ff
CIE-LAB 35.313, 77.398, -100.515
XYZ 20.239, 8.656, 91.866
xyY 0.168, 0.072, 8.656
CIE-LCH 35.313, 126.86, 307.597
CIE-LUV 35.313, -3.516, -130.984
Hunter-Lab 29.421, 71.306, -164.537
Binary 01001000, 00001110, 11111011

Shades and Tints of #480efb

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03000a is the darkest color, while #f8f6ff is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#480efb is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#3a3a3a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#3d3161 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#0059ad Protanopia 1% of men
  • #005e95 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#006569 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#1a3ec9 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#1a41ba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#1a459e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
